Rap and hip-hop artist Tonik Slam drops debut solo album ‘Hell-A-Cold’ Ft. KokaneRap and hip-hop artist Tonik Slam a.k.a., Got Loonch? has today dropped his debut solo album ‘Hell-A-Cold’ on Cakestation Records, featuring westcoast hip-hop legend Kokane and available now to listen to on Tonik Slam’s official SoundCloud page. ‘Hell-A-Cold’ illustrates Tonik Slam’s ‘Cold Сoast’ sound, which references the surroundings the album was recorded and mixed in - YBC (Yekaterinburg), the fourth-largest city in Russia. Mixed by fellow YBCer PooakaW, the album features collaborations with hook master and Guinness Book of World Records holder for most featured recording artist, Kokane. Tonik Slam and Kokane collaborate on 7 tracks for ‘Hell-A-Cold’, including features by American rapper Kurupt on tracks like, "Swimmin' Wit Sharks" & "Heaven Ain't My Road." Tonik Slam has been performing since 2006 and has opened the stage for well-known rap artists such as ONYX, Raekwon from Wu-Tang Clan, XZIBIT and Serial Killers. His influences include 2PAC, Eminem, Snoop Dogg & Kokane, Obie Trice and G-Unit.
